Who is David Sandström?
David Sandström is the Chief Marketing Officer at Klarna, known for innovative digital marketing strategies, user-centric campaigns, and leading growth in fintech through data-driven and creative brand initiatives. His leadership focuses on blending technology with marketing to create seamless customer experiences.
